Australia is welcoming more migrants but they lack the skills to build more houses

  • Written by Brendan Coates, Program Director, Economic Policy, Grattan Institute

Australia has an acute shortage of housing. Renters across the country face steep rents rises and record-low vacancy rates.

At the same time, net overseas migration has surged to a record high of 518,100 in the past financial year as international students, working holiday-makers, and sponsored workers returned to Australia after our international...
